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2008-06-21 | client: Read stsz atom containing frame sizes | Lars-Dominik Braun | 4 | -174/+315 | |
This has two advantages: 1) We can pass the correct amount of bytes to NeAACDecDecode (). This should fix some decoding error messages. And 2) We can show the length of the song and the remaining (or already played time) to the user. Cool, eh? | |||||
2008-06-20 | client: Pause implemented | Lars-Dominik Braun | 2 | -8/+28 | |
2008-06-20 | client: Static buffer (player thread) | Lars-Dominik Braun | 1 | -36/+28 | |
2008-06-20 | client: Rework main loop. | Lars-Dominik Braun | 1 | -129/+156 | |
Make whole thing more independent from player thread. Not the best solution yet (not bulletproof ;)), but well... | |||||
2008-06-19 | client: Improve key-binding help | Lars-Dominik Braun | 2 | -1/+54 | |
2008-06-19 | Showing real face now. | Lars-Dominik Braun | 1 | -2/+2 | |
User agent is now PACKAGE_STRING | |||||
2008-06-19 | "Add more music" implemented | Lars-Dominik Braun | 1 | -37/+58 | |
This can add more track/artist seeds to the currently played station | |||||
2008-06-18 | client: curl expects write callback to return size_t | Lars-Dominik Braun | 1 | -2/+2 | |
2008-06-17 | Use config.h | Lars-Dominik Braun | 1 | -0/+1 | |
2008-06-17 | lib: Move sources to src | Lars-Dominik Braun | 1 | -2/+2 | |
2008-06-17 | Removed @author and @added as they are tracked by git | Lars-Dominik Braun | 2 | -8/+0 | |
2008-06-17 | More error handling. | Lars-Dominik Braun | 1 | -2/+9 | |
Now we can parse and handle pandora's <fault> messages and abort the parsing process. Some more fault type should be added, as well as more client support for those errors. | |||||
2008-06-16 | client: Proxy type config option added | Lars-Dominik Braun | 4 | -5/+33 | |
2008-06-15 | client: Manpage added | Lars-Dominik Braun | 2 | -1/+44 | |
2008-06-15 | client: Removed unneeded debugging printf's; some more documentation for ↵ | Lars-Dominik Braun | 3 | -15/+21 | |
functions | |||||
2008-06-15 | client: Config file added, not yet documented | Lars-Dominik Braun | 6 | -9/+240 | |
Some restructuring was necessary too. | |||||
2008-06-14 | Finally implemented "create station" | Lars-Dominik Braun | 1 | -0/+79 | |
This may be a bit buggy, because no return values are checked or returned. A big cleanup session is waiting... | |||||
2008-06-13 | Hopefully fixed wrong libxml2 usage | Lars-Dominik Braun | 2 | -2/+6 | |
We did a xmlCleanupParser () call everytime we finished parsing; this is wrong (http://xmlsoft.org/html/libxml-parser.html#xmlCleanupParser) | |||||
2008-06-12 | client: Fix segfaults when changing station, banning and skipping tracks | Lars-Dominik Braun | 1 | -3/+6 | |
This was caused by reading uninitialized memory. It was freed by PianoDestroyPlaylist. | |||||
2008-06-12 | client: Station deleting added | Lars-Dominik Braun | 1 | -1/+18 | |
2008-06-11 | client: Station renaming implemented | Lars-Dominik Braun | 2 | -1/+18 | |
2008-06-10 | Do not love tracks twice. | Lars-Dominik Braun | 1 | -1/+6 | |
2008-06-10 | Return success/error in PianoRateTrack | Lars-Dominik Braun | 1 | -6/+12 | |
2008-06-10 | fix love and ban | Lars-Dominik Braun | 1 | -4/+6 | |
2008-06-10 | Added missing files to repo | Lars-Dominik Braun | 2 | -0/+345 | |